Market Overview

The Global Photodynamic Therapy Market achieved a valuation of USD 1.5 billion in 2023 and is projected to reach USD 3.3 billion by 2032, exhibiting a strong compound annual growth rate of 8.8%.

This expansion is fueled by an increasing prevalence of cancer and dermatological disorders, rising demand for minimally invasive procedures, and the growing adoption of PDT due to its reduced side effects and rapid recovery time.

PDT is increasingly used for treating multiple conditions, including non-melanoma skin cancers, actinic keratosis, psoriasis, acne, and certain ophthalmic and oral diseases. As healthcare providers focus on personalized treatment approaches, PDT's ability to target diseased tissues while sparing healthy cells positions it as a strategic component in next-generation treatment systems.

Market Dynamics

The market growth is significantly driven by increased awareness regarding PDT as a clinically validated and cosmetically favorable therapeutic option.

Unlike chemotherapy and radiation therapy, photodynamic therapy uses photosensitizing agents and specific wavelengths of light to selectively eliminate abnormal cells, resulting in fewer systemic complications.

Furthermore, research developments in photosensitizers are enhancing light absorption efficiency and treatment precision, making PDT more effective for deeply seated lesions and broadening its clinical applications.

However, the market faces certain limitations. PDT requires specialized equipment and skilled professionals for safe and efficient implementation, and the treatment may not be suitable for all forms of aggressive cancer.

High costs associated with advanced laser devices and uneven global availability also challenge widespread adoption. Despite these hurdles, increasing healthcare expenditure, rising investments in oncology research, and expanding distribution networks of pharmaceutical companies continue to support the sustained growth of the Photodynamic Therapy Market.

Market Segmentation

The Photodynamic Therapy Market can be segmented by product type, drug type, light source, application, and end user. Based on product type, the market includes photosensitizing drugs, PDT devices, and disposables, with photosensitizers dominating due to high utilization rates across cancer and skin disease treatments.

Light sources are segmented into lasers, LEDs, and other illumination systems, with lasers accounting for the highest share owing to their precision and controlled wavelength delivery. Applications span oncology, dermatology, ophthalmology, and dentistry, with oncology remaining the largest treatment area due to the rising burden of cancer cases globally.

End-user segmentation comprises hospitals, specialty clinics, and ambulatory care centers, where hospitals continue to lead because of advanced clinical infrastructure and skilled medical personnel, while specialized dermatology clinics are emerging as fast-growing users due to increased patient interest in cosmetic and skin-restoration PDT.

Regional Analysis

North America remained the dominant region in the Global Photodynamic Therapy Market in 2023, securing approximately 39.2% of the total market share. The region’s strong leadership stems from high cancer prevalence levels and growing incidences of severe and chronic skin conditions that require frequent treatment interventions.

The United States alone accounted for more than 21% of global cancer cases and nearly 14% of treatment administrations in 2018, amplifying investment in oncology treatment technologies. The presence of major pharmaceutical and medical device developers, strong R&D activities, and the availability of skilled healthcare professionals further strengthen the region’s competitive advantage.

Additionally, the region benefits from highly advanced healthcare infrastructure, a supportive regulatory environment for medical innovation, and widespread adoption of laser-based and minimally invasive treatments. The growing geriatric population and extended life expectancy levels further elevate market demand, as age-related disorders and skin malignancies become more prevalent.

Rapid integration of PDT into outpatient treatment models and the increasing acceptance of cosmetic dermatological solutions also contribute to the region’s progressive market expansion.

Frequently Asked Questions (FAQs)

1. What is photodynamic therapy?
Photodynamic therapy is a minimally invasive treatment that uses light-sensitive drugs and specific wavelengths of light to destroy abnormal or cancerous cells without causing damage to surrounding healthy tissues.

2. What are the key benefits of photodynamic therapy?
PDT offers precise cell targeting, reduced side effects, minimal scarring or tissue damage, faster recovery, and suitability for multiple medical and dermatological conditions.

3. Which medical fields use photodynamic therapy the most?
PDT is widely used in oncology and dermatology, followed by its increasing use in ophthalmology, dentistry, and certain immune-related conditions.
